I had applied for the graduate scheme.
Two weeks after applying, I received an invitation for a HackerRank test. It consisted of two easy and one medium LeetCode-style questions on arrays and data structures, and a system design question.
About a week later, I received an invitation for an HR screening round. This was a 30-minute call with one of the HR representatives, discussing my motivation, career aspirations, and what the company has to offer.
After this, the final 1-1 interview rounds were scheduled for around three weeks later (assessment centre).
On the interview day, three team members at various levels (senior developer, manager, senior manager) conducted 1-1 competency-based interviews, 30 minutes each.
After this, a group interview with three other candidates was held to discuss and create a strategy for a given problem.
After the interview, I received a call five days later with the offer.
Competency-based "tell me about a time" questions.
